Output 76f2a05f0fa23060fae10f57a874e42886e50bb418fc8e133e18b1f84246b4f6:3

value
66218602746
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d5f420ab361925cd53949fea3a332035e34c786 OP_EQUALVERIFY OP_CHECKSIG
address
LQpTbZ8oD4Q2WnbvsscBtfXku6wZxfJebN
transaction
76f2a05f0fa23060fae10f57a874e42886e50bb418fc8e133e18b1f84246b4f6
spent
true